About the Topic
Bone conduction headphones are audio devices that transmit sound waves through the bones in the skull rather than through the eardrums. This technology allows users to hear audio while keeping their ears open to ambient sounds, making it ideal for activities where situational awareness is important, such as running or cycling. These headphones are particularly beneficial for individuals with certain types of hearing loss or those who prefer to maintain awareness of their surroundings while listening to audio.
